Voltage and Amperage Explained
It’s important to understand that a 12V power supply delivers a constant voltage of 12 volts. The 10 Amp rating indicates the maximum current it can provide. I realized that exceeding this limit could damage both my power supply and the devices I intended to power. Therefore, I made sure to calculate the total amperage required by my devices to ensure compatibility.
Type of Power Supply
I learned that there are different types of 12V power supplies available, including linear and switching models. Linear power supplies tend to be larger and heavier, providing stable voltage with minimal noise, while switching power supplies are more compact and efficient. I had to decide which type suited my needs best based on factors like size and noise tolerance.

Cooling Mechanism
I noticed that the cooling mechanism could vary between models. Some power supplies use passive cooling, while others have built-in fans. I evaluated my environment to determine which option would work best for me, considering factors like ambient temperature and noise levels.
